One of the largest telecom service provider in India Bharat Sanchar Nigam Limited (BSNL) all set to launch unique mobile banking platform to help the mobile subscribers to transfer money electronically.
According to the Operator, It will be more helpful to send money instantly in rural parts of India wherein the Banking infrastructures is yet not good. This will SMS based service in association with India Post. Receiver will be able to encash the SMS at all post offices in the country.
In order to send money, go to the nearest post office and transfer the money by way of an SMS. The SMS will contain a unique code. The person who receives this SMS real time, can go to his nearest post office and collect the money by showing the code. This will also help those who do not have a proper address for physical delivery of the money order.
Mr R. K. Agarwal, BSNL Director for Consumer Mobility, stated that “BSNL Money Transfer platform had been test-piloted in Chandigarh and the company expects to roll out the service in association with the postal department, after getting the Reserve Bank of India’s approval”
